Ups2Cen is a F-type (Yellow-White) star located in the constellation Centaurus. It carries the designation Ups2Cen.
At a distance of roughly 1,269 light-years, Ups2Cen is a distant star lying deep within the Milky Way galaxy.
Ups2Cen is classified as a spectral class F star (F-type (Yellow-White)) on the Harvard spectral classification system.
With an apparent magnitude of +4.34, Ups2Cen sits near the limit of naked-eye visibility. It can be glimpsed without optical aid under dark skies, but binoculars will make observation much easier. Observers will note its white hue, which corresponds to a B-V color index of +0.598.
